I think I need a clarification.

As I understand it, what you are calling "gun rugs" really are rifle or pistol cases.

Among my shooting buddies and at the local ranges, indoor and outdoor, a gun rug is what you put down on the bench to rest the firearm on when you're not shooting it. And at at least one outdoor range, if you're shooting a revolver off sandbags, they require you to have one over the sandbag because of flash and escaping gases in the gap between cylinder and forcing cone.

I have seen same for sale, but I've been using old carpet remnants and outdated carpet samples for years.
